Do car warranties transfer when sold?

When a vehicle is sold or otherwise transferred, the manufacturer warranty follows the vehicle and not the owner. For example, if you purchase a two-year-old vehicle that has 20,000 miles on the odometer, the manufacturer's warranty is still valid for another year or 16,000 miles, in most cases.

What is Nissan's factory warranty?

Almost every Nissan – including yours - comes with a 3-year/36,000 mile limited warranty, and a 5-year limited powertrain warranty. For enhanced protection, Nissan also offers optional extended warranties.

What does the Nissan 100000 mile warranty cover?

If a CPO vehicle is approved to be sold at a Nissan dealership, it comes with a 7-year/100,000-mile limited powertrain warranty that covers the engine, transmission, transfer case and drivetrain. The manufacturer guarantees any repairs or replacements will be made with genuine Nissan parts.

What does 5 year 60000 mile warranty mean?

Powertrain: The powertrain warranty comes hand in hand with the bumper-to-bumper warranty, but it typically lasts a little longer; most automakers offer it for up to five years or 60,000 miles, whichever comes first. It covers only the parts that make the vehicle go: the engine, transmission, and drivetrain.

Can I cancel my Nissan extended warranty?

You can also cancel your Nissan extended warranty through the dealership. If you financed your extended warranty plan with the purchase of your vehicle, the cancellation refund will be sent to the lienholder unless you can provide proof that you paid the loan off.

Can I buy a Nissan extended warranty?

Yes, as long as you purchase it before the Nissan factory warranty expires. You can buy a Nissan extended warranty from your local dealership for a term of up to 8 years/120,000 miles, whichever comes first.

Does warranty reset after replacement?

No matter how many repairs or replacements you receive in relation to an original product, that time limit still stands - so the replacement product would only be under guarantee for whatever time period was still remaining from the original guarantee.
